The Master of Applied Finance is offered at the University of Adelaide, which operates multiple campuses including the Adelaide City Campus, perfectly positioned on North Terrace in the Central Business District (CBD) of Adelaide, South Australia.
Adelaide University is a member of the Group of Eight research-intensive universities and aims to be ranked in the top 1% of universities globally. The university celebrates diversity and has a vibrant and inclusive student community designed to empower students and help them explore their passions.
Adelaide is described as one of Australia's most liveable cities, embracing opportunities in education, energy, space, advanced manufacturing, food and wine, creative industries and healthcare. It balances urban living with natural landscapes and has a strong sense of community, making it an attractive place to study and build a career.
Yes, Adelaide University aims to be ranked as the best university nationally for student employment outcomes, indicating a strong focus on launching students into rewarding careers after graduation.
